Zaheer, Harbhajan strike at Eden Gardens; South Africa 266/9 on Day 1
Written by Breaking News Online Team
Sunday, 14 February 2010 23:22
Kolkata: Breaking News! Pacer Zaheer Khan and ace spinner Harbhajan Singh strike hard to leave South Africa stranded at 266/9 at stumps on Day 1, after Hashim Amla and debutant Alviro Petersen hit centuries. India got the top honours on the first day.

Chennai: The blame game has begun over India's humiliating defeat in Nagpur Test. While skipper Dhoni passed the buck to the selectors, saying he and the coach were not the final authority behind the selection, Chief Selector, Kris Srikkanth offered to resign over this issue.

New Delhi: India's leading manufacturer of two-wheeler vehicles, Hero Honda rubbished the media reports that it has decided to buy IPL team, Kings XI Punjab (KXIP) for a whopping $260 million. Kings XI Punjab is currently owned by Preity Zinta and Nes Wadia. The company confirmed that no such plan was discussed at any level and it was just a rumour.
